Journal ArticleDOI

Evaluation of the impact of in ovo administered bacteria on microbiome of chicks through 10 days of age.

TL;DR: Different isolates provided in ovo can have an impact on the initial microbiome of the GIT, and some of these differences in ceca remain notable at 10 D.
Journal ArticleDOI

Research Note: Evaluating fecal shedding of oocysts in relation to body weight gain and lesion scores during Eimeria infection.

TL;DR: Incorporation of OPG, with BWG and lesion scores, as test parameters to measure coccidiosis intervention strategies, provides a global description of disease that may not otherwise be observed with the 2 latter measurements alone.
Journal ArticleDOI

Intestinal pioneer colonizers as drivers of ileal microbial composition and diversity of broiler chickens

TL;DR: It is demonstrated that intestinal pioneer colonizers play a critical role in driving the course of microbial community composition and diversity over time, in which early life exposure to L-based probiotic supported selection alongside greater colonization of symbiotic populations in the ileum of young broilers.
Journal ArticleDOI

Comparison of multiple methods for induction of necrotic enteritis in broilers. I

TL;DR: A predisposing factor, such as EM, was required for development of clinical signs, gross macroscopic lesions, and decreased BWG when broilers were fed a standard diet when birds consumed a standard corn‐soy diet in these experiments.
Journal ArticleDOI

A Proteomic View of the Cross-Talk Between Early Intestinal Microbiota and Poultry Immune System.

TL;DR: Proper immune function was dependent on specific GIT microbiota profiles, in which early-life exposure to L-based probiotic may have modulated the immune functions, whereas neonatal colonization of Enterobacteriaceae strains may have led to immune dysregulation associated with chronic inflammation.
